Output 8ec2b250e739943a9fef40fc38692665671ca7c4be65cf7ead7e0bb26e81c7a2:7

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 10016376168470a26bc81e0884df35ac83f72d2d9f078d155fe37ec9366324b1
address
bc1pzqqkxasks3c2y67grcygfhe44jplwtfdnurc692ludlvjdnryjcsa09wau
transaction
8ec2b250e739943a9fef40fc38692665671ca7c4be65cf7ead7e0bb26e81c7a2
spent
true